Introduction to Jack’s and Their Menu
Jack’s is a fast-food restaurant chain that operates primarily in the southeastern United States. Known for their Southern-style cooking, Jack’s offers a variety of menu items, including burgers, chicken sandwiches, and breakfast favorites like the sausage biscuit. Their menu is designed to be affordable and appealing to a wide range of customers, from early morning commuters to families looking for a quick dinner.
